    Default Re: htc evo v 4g....rooting and jellybean help

    There are several jb roms that have everything working except 3d....check android forums and xda.

    To flash a jb or non sense based Rom you most likely need to.lower your hboot version, which requires s off. Once you lower your hboot you can flash roms that are made for the evo.3d, and then a little more work is required to get mms working, but there are flashable zips and guides to get you there.

  17. #17  

    Default Re: htc evo v 4g....rooting and jellybean help

    If you are s off, all you need to do is download the pg86img.IMG file for the 1.50 hboot.

    Put that on the root of your sd card.

    Reboot into bootloader, and apply the update.

    Just make sure you rename or move it when you're done.

    Also a stock rom will bootloop on lower than 1.57, so flash harmonia real quick and then change your hboot...it'll save you a headache in the future

    Default Re: htc evo v 4g....rooting and jellybean help

    I would flash harmonia first as it should work with any hboot.....if you change the hboot on stock Rom you will boot loop


    1) make a nandroid if you haven't yet
    2) flash harmonia
    3) change hboot
    4) reboot to harmonia and delete/rename/or move pg86 file
    5) in recovery do a full wipe
    6) flash new Rom / gapps
